Wasted Vordt boss soul so now I can't obtain Pontiff's Left Eye ring?
Like any normal player I used the Soul of Boreal Valley Vordt to obtain souls and level up then later I realized it was a regeant/materal needed to craft the OP life stealing ring called Pontiff's Left Eye ring. As far as I know there is no way to repeat this boss since he's dead and doesn't show up when I go to the same area again. Am I going to have to restart a new character to obtain this ring or is there any way that I can avoid being thoroughly ♥♥♥♥♥♥ by this horrid game design?

Artek [General] Jan 6, 2017 @ 5:46pm 
Originally posted by Derplord:
I'm entitled to my opinion. Lets not stray off topic or this whole thing will get deleted by overzealous mods. Artek if i start a new game now will it delete my old character? I'm scared to even click the button otherwise I may loose all my progress so far.
Well you can start a new character (which is actually a good decision, because vordt is an early game boss and you wont loose TOO much of a progress). It wont delete the old one, but what's the point then?

OR you can finish the whole game and then just do a new game+ after the final boss.
The game will start all over from the begining, but you'll keep your levels and all of the loot you've collected. Only the journey itself will reset (you will also to do all the things again like opening shortcuts, buying keys to open doors, yadi yada).
Also enemies will become stronger and have increased health pool and damage output.
